Operating Race Rules
Intent of Rules
The organisers of this event believes in promoting good sportsmanship and fair play in the activities we engage in. This means observance of these race rules as well as generally accepted rules of behaviour and all governmental laws. Paddlers are to avoid situations where a canoe is deliberately rammed, where assaults and/or abusive language are used. Coaches and Captains from different clubs are required to support and enforce these race rules and to avoid any circumvention of these rules. Race Officials and Officers are required to do their best to be fair and not biased in their decisions and in carrying out their duties.
Safety Requirements:
Weather report must be monitored to ensure weather conditions are favourable. In the case the Hong Kong Government issue T3 or beyond, the race will be canceled for the next weekend.
A course may be altered during the course of an event.
Each race should have at least one safety boat.
Fill up the Waiver
PFD are mandatory for all paddlers. In some exception (flat conditions) a Waist PFD will be allowed.
Leash is mandatory
For OC1/OC2 a spare paddle is recommended.
Bring your phone and share your live location in the Whatsapp group. Organisers will create a Whatsapp group for all season.

Scoring Rules:
Paddlers must race a minimum of three (3) Races to participate in the leaderboard. This applies to OC6 crews as well.
Each category must have a least three (3) participants who satisfy the three race minimum requirement to be able to participate in the Leaderboard.
Point-Series will be awarded for long course only. No short-course race will be eligible.
A 12-point system will be used for small craft (single and double), with 1st place receiving 12 points, 2nd place receiving 11 points, and so on. A 12th place and beyond will receive 1 point. Only the 5 best results out of 8 races will count.
A 6-point system will be used for OC6, with 1st place receiving 6 points, 2nd place receiving 5 points, and so on. A 6th place and beyond will receive 1 point. All OC6 races will count for the final score.
The OC6 Race divisions are: Open, Women and Mixed. Only Standard Boats are allowed (no UL/Malolo).
The OC6 Series Club Champion (the only reward for OC6) will be the club that accumulate the most point across all divisions.
